Bodkins Close is in Boughton Monchelsea, Maidstone and in Maidstone district. ME17 4TS is located in the Boughton Monchelsea & Chart Sutton elect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Faversham and Mid Kent. This postcode has been in use since 1999-12-01.

Safety

Is Bodkins Close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Bodkins Close was 73.8 per 1,000 residents, which is 68.3% higher than the Bearsted & Downswood average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Bodkins Close has the 26th highest crime rate of 108 local areas in Bearsted & Downswood and the 174th highest crime rate of 511 local areas in Maidstone .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 45.1 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 60.4%.
